The diagonals of a rhombus measure 8 cm by 6 cm. What is the length of a side of the rhombus?​
Ratling [72]
Answer:
5 cm

Step-by-step explanation:
In a rhombus,
1 diagonal = 8 cm (left - right)
2 diagonal = 6 cm (top - bottom)

There will be 4 triangles in a rhombus when bisected with 2 intersecting diagonals (all 4 will have equal measures).

Then,
Base of 1 triangle = 8/2 = 4 cm
Altitude of 2 triangle = 6/2 = 3 cm

Hypotenuse of 1 triangle = Longest side of triangle = Side of rhombus = ?

Using pythagorean property,
√((4)² + (3)²) = Hypotenuse
√(16 + 9) = Hypotenuse
√25 = Hypotenuse
5 cm = Hypotenuse = 1 side of rhombus
